Until now, there has been no one text that discusses the norms, beliefs, and behaviours that affect how societies respond to HIV/AIDS around the world. This volume synthesizes data from anthropology, psychology, sociology, biology, and medicine, and incorporates the author's more than two decades of work in the field.
